Intersecting a wellbore
Goal
Convey TVD uncertainty during wellbore intersection.
Description
Driller or Operator unintentionally sidetracks a well significantly above TD, and wishes to re-enter the mother bore with the sidetracked well with minimum dog-leg severity. This operation will save having to drill an entire sidetrack to TD. There are several issues here all related to uncertainty (a) detecting that an unintentional sidetrack has occurred, (b) steering back to the mother bore at very slight small inclination and azimuth differences to avoid significant dogleg. Reference: Rio Oil & Gas Expo and Conference 2020, From TLWP: Lessons Learned From Voluntary and Involuntary Sidetracks, Rohlfs de Macedo et al., IBP0804_20 (to be published December 2020).
